Time optimal control problem is a standard problem of Pontryagin Maximum Principle. In order to give a detailed exposition of the proof, the paper is mostly self–contained, which forces us to consider diﬀerent areas in mathematics such as algebra, analysis, geometry. Finally, numerical examples are presented to illustrate the validness of the theoretical results. Pontryagin maximum principle 13 • Maximum function max v∈U H(t,x ∗(t),v,p(t),λ 0) is continuous on [0,T∗] and satisﬁes at T∗ max v∈U H(T∗,x∗(T∗),v,p(T∗),λ 0) = 0. • Necessary conditions for optimization of dynamic systems. Message: The maximum principle generalizes the equation f′(x) = 0. THE MAXIMUM PRINCIPLE: CONTINUOUS TIME • Main Purpose: Introduce the maximum principle as a necessary condition to be satisﬁed by any optimal control. In these talks, I will introduce the Pontryagin maximum principle. Features of the Bellman principle and the HJB equation I The Bellman principle is based on the "law of iterated conditional expectations". 